- 博客(7)
- 收藏
- 关注
原创 SLAMCraft:自主导航机器人DIY(二)快来从零设计你的机器人控制板
文章目录项目往期文章一、电路设计环境搭建1.1 EDA软件安装1.2 立创开源广场二、原理图设计2.1 硬件的系统设计2.2 电源部分(Power)2.2.1 MP2482的降压方案2.2.2 AMS1117的降压方案2.2.3 电源接口与保护2.3 最小系统(SystemCore)2.4 外设部分(HardWear)2.4.1 GPIO外设电路2.4.2 串口接口电路2.4.3 I2C接口电路2.4.4 SPI接口电路2.4.5 CAN接口电路2.4.6 PWM外设电路2.5 layout注意事项三.
2024-05-01 20:44:26 1705 6
原创 SLAMCraft:自主导航机器人DIY(一)如何设计一个SLAM机器人
本项目的主要目标是设计和开发一个具有SLAM功能的小型移动机器人。通过该项目,我们将深入探讨SLAM技术的核心概念,包括传感器融合、数据处理算法、运动学模型等方面的知识。同时,我们将以实践为主线,引导读者从零开始,逐步完成一个完整的SLAM机器人系统。SLAM(Simultaneous Localization and Mapping),即建图与导航。SLAM机器人是一类拥有自主定位和地图构建能力的智能移动机器人。它们能够在未知环境中实时确定自己的位置并同时构建周围环境的地图。
2023-11-13 15:00:02 774 3
原创 Error: L6218E: Undefined symbol
Keil5中Error: L6218E: Undefined symbol系列问题解决方法(遇到后就更新)
2023-11-10 17:13:12 1888
原创 全网最简单的stm32f103c8t6移植ucosiii教程(附移植好的工程)
最近在做一个机器人项目,需要使用到stm32f103c8t6核心板。考虑程序中的多任务特性,因此决定使用ucosiii用于多任务管理。ucosiii移植可能对于一些嵌入式老鸟来说,可能是信手拈来,但是对于很多新手特别是刚入门的小白来说还是有一定的难度的。尤其是全网的移植教程过于杂乱良莠不齐,甚至有些博主将移植好的工程设置为付费下载。这里决定分享下我的移植过程,并在最后附上工程模板以供学习和参考。
2023-04-16 15:29:57 5635 4
原创 要做单片机课课设的快看过来:KEIL安装以及C51环境搭建和Protues安装保姆教程
protues、keil的安装教程以及51单片机课程实验项目的开源和教学
2022-06-20 17:57:41 3658 3
原创 第七届工程训练大赛垃圾分类
第七届全国大学生工程训练大赛垃圾分类前言一、机械结构设计二、视觉识别部分1.引入库2.识别部分三、上下位机通信方式:1.高低电平通信:1.2高低电平树莓派部分:2.stm32串口通信部分:四、下位机电机驱动部分1.电机:涡轮蜗杆电机(履带负载较大,不可直接用步进直流电机)2.有关于延时的改进:3.stm32主函数:五、炸电机:文章目录前言一、机械结构设计二、视觉识别部分1.引入库2.识别部分三、上下位机通信方式:1.高低电平通信:1.2高低电平树莓派部分:2.stm32串口通信部分:四、下位机电机驱动
2021-04-13 16:02:24 20938 49
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人